Akwa United 1-1 Rivers United
The Pride of Rivers showed their mental strength once more to begin the second stanza with a point on the road.
Mathew Etim put the ball into his own net to gift Stanley Eguma's side the lead going into the break. Just two minutes after the restart, the hosts found their equaliser through debutant Adeyeye Adeyemi.
Efforts to find the winner by Deji Ayeni's men were thwarted by Sochima Victor and his defence as the visitors went away with a point from the Nest of Champions.
Kwara United 2-1 Remo Stars
The Harmony boys came from a goal down to beat the Ikenne side at the Kwara Sports Complex on Sunday.
It was a cagey half hour until Haruna Hadi, in his first start for the Sky Blues Stars, shocked the home side to put the visitors in front. Just on the stroke of halftime, Kwara United found a response when Kabiru Balogun headed home the equaliser.
From there on, it became a ding-dong affair with both sides going in search of the winning goal. It was Abdullahi Biffo's men who eventually found the winner with fifteen minutes to go when Balogun's cross was turned home by Samad Kadiri.
The win sent Kwara United above Remo Stars, who dropped to fifth, on the league standings.

Kano Pillars suffered a narrow 1-0 defeat at Gombe United courtesy Barnabas Daniel's second half penalty. Jonas Emmanuel's spectacular goal handed Niger Tornadoes all three points against Dakkada in Kaduna.
In Lagos, MFM edged fellow relegation battlers Heartland FC at the Teslim Balogun Stadium to increase their chances of survival. Micah Ojodomo scored the game's only goal.
Abel James and Victor Mbaoma scored to help Enyimba nick a 2-0 win over Wikki Tourists in Aba, while Kolade Adeniji's goal for Sunshine Stars ended Plateau United's 11-game unbeaten run.
In Makurdi, Mohammed Baba Ganaru's return to management in the topflight ended on a sweet note. Raphael Ayagwa and Godfrey Utin scored to inflict just the second defeat in ten away games on the Flying Antelopes.
At their newly adopted homeground, Nasarawa United avenged their defeat in Ibadan about two weeks ago as Adamu Hassan and Shammasu Mohammed scored in the second half to send Shooting Stars back to their base empty handed.
